Stacking Forms
This class will focus on throwing tall and stacking forms. Students will be guided through exercises that build the skills needed to throw taller and more even walled cylinders. Next, they will learn to throw cylinders of the same diameter and gain experience with joining them together on the wheel. These stacked forms will then be further thrown, stretched, and shaped into a final form greater than the sum of the parts. If you want to learn to throw taller and stack parts on the wheel, this class is for you.
This is an intermediate level class. Students should have a strong understanding of the throwing process. Class fee includes one 25 lb. bag of clay.
